There are plenty of exciting activities and sights in the area, such as the Hitachi Seaside Park, known for its seasonal flower gardens, and the Aqua World Ibaraki Oarai Aquarium, a popular spot for marine life and dolphin shows. The nearby Ajigaura Beach offers opportunities for swimming and fishing. For culture enthusiasts, the historic Kairakuen, a park first landscaped in 1842, is a must-visit destination.
